About the Author:
Kimchi: Essential Recipes of the Korean Kitchen is by Byung-Hi Lim and Byung-Soon Lim, who share a lineage of authentic Korean home cooking and a passion for preserving traditional methods while inviting modern cooks into the kitchen. Our Korean Kitchen is authored by Jordan Bourke, a chef and food writer, in collaboration with Rejina Pyo, a designer who brings a fresh, culturally aware perspective to everyday cooking. Together, these authors fuse heritage with contemporary appeal: the Lim sisters provide time-honored, reliable kimchi techniques and family recipes, while Bourke and Pyo translate Korean flavors into approachable, stylish dishes that resonate with today’s readers.
